My father was a WWII Marine vet. A while back some of you guys helped me identify all of his accumulated medals (thank you). Dad died back in 2017 at the rich old age of 94. I took all of his medals and a copy of the letter my mother got back in 1945 when dad took a bullet on Okinawa. I engraved the back of Dad's purple heart with his name etc. I wanted to preserve this as best I could so I mounted it up in a display. I was pretty damned proud of how it turned out.

I kind of know where you are coming from Dennis. My father in law was drafted to go to Vietnam. He was okay with this as this was his patriotic duty to his country. Well, turns out his platoon was on roaming duties through some rice fields when he heard a click, he told his closest platoon mates to scatter and he jumped off to the side and the mine took his leg. Unfortunately, he was only there for 5 days when this happened. The government never acknowledged he was even there. Fast forward to present, I thought he would like his medals encased such as you have done. Come to find out the Army never put in his paperwork for his medals so we are fighting that now. Hopefully they soon come through so he can get the recognition he deserves. Never once have I heard him complain about going or losing his leg at age 19.
